Grover v. Hawley
Citations
- 5 Cal. 485
Syllabus
<p>Prior possession of public lands will entitle the possessor to maintain an action against a trespasser.</p> <p>The right of enjoyment of possession to public lands may descend among the effects of a deceased person to the executor or administrator, and the right of the deceased be conveyed by a regular sale to another.</p>
